Description

This document is a legal subpoena issued by the Montgomery County District Court in the State of Kansas, dated March 1893 (pp. 1-2). It commands individuals to appear as witnesses in the criminal case of The State of Kansas vs. Emmet Dalton (p. 2).

Page 1: Subpoena Filing and Return

No: 7287
Court: Montgomery County District Court
Parties: The State of Kansas (Plaintiff) vs. Emmet Dalton (Defendant)
Filed: March 8, 1893, by W.C. Foreman, Clerk
Service Record: Received on March 7, 1893. Executed on March 7, 1893, by delivering a copy to Chas K. Smith and James Parker.
Signatures: T.F. Callahan, Sheriff; By Chas Morgan, Deputy.
Fees Incurred: Totaling $5.65, including mileage for 44 miles ($4.40), the subpoena ($0.75), and copies ($0.50) (p. 1).

Page 2: Formal Command

To: Chas K. Smith & James Parker
Command: "You and each of you are hereby commanded to be and appear in your proper person before the District Court... on the 8th day of March 1893 at 8:30 o'clock a.m."
Testimony For: The Defendant
Witnessed: Signed by W.C. Foreman, Clerk, on March 7, 1893.
